Mission:

The Community Liver Alliance is dedicated to supporting the community through liver disease awareness, prevention, education and research.

The Community Liver Alliance builds bridges connecting patients to health care providers and services; supports the Children's Hospital of Pittsburgh youth transplant camp; creates and conducts screenings, educational workshops and seminars; coordinates support groups; provides patient assistance; funds local research; works with local media and community groups to increase awareness of liver wellness and liver disease; and meets with local, state, and federal policy makers to initiate positive change.
